Hip-hop (also known as rap music or simply rap) is a genre of popular music that emerged in the early 1970s alongside an associated subculture created by African-American and Afro-Caribbean communities in New York City. The musical style is a synthesis of a wide range of techniques, but rapping is frequent enough that it has become a defining…
